## Changelog — turnstile-counter v2.4.1

Rotated the signing key for the Pennick Stadium turnstile counter firmware after the quarterly audit. Old key revoked in the Gatefold registry; all v2.4.x builds must be re-signed before flashing. No functional changes. Counter drift fix deferred to v2.5. Builds signed with the prior key will fail attestation. New key follows below.

signing key of bagap-yawep = bky13_TbfT6ZMUoGJo2

- [ ] Step 7: Archive cold storage buckets (Glacierline tier). Confirm both ceremony witnesses are present, verify bucket manifests match the Oxbow ledger, then seal the archive key shares. Plugin authors may observe but not handle shares. Once sealed, the archive index itself is encrypted and can only be reopened with the passphrase below.

vault phrase of badup-hahig = tamael-aldael-kelmir-istael-fenok-istwyn-tamius-jorath-oliion

**Pickwise Optimizer — Onboarding Note**

Pickwise recalculates warehouse pick routes every four minutes using bin congestion data from the Harlowe floor sensors. New joiners should know that route overrides from shift leads always win, even when scores disagree. Deployment happens Tuesdays after the eng sync. Setup steps and dashboard access instructions live on the internal page below.

operations page: https://jira.qorvelsys.internal/browse/pages/browse/pages

**Step 4 — Ship the seat-map renderer**

Once the Playbill Hall seat-map bundle passes visual diff checks, push it to the edge cache and bust stale tiles. Nothing fancy here — it's a static bundle. The uploader does require a signed manifest, though, so sign it with the key below.

rollout seal: bky4_x7Gc